Abstract

The invention provides a method for extracting vanadium by leaching vanadium-contained raw material roasting clinkers through ammonium phosphate. The method includes the steps that a mixture of a vanadium-contained raw material and an additive is roasted, and the vanadium-contained raw material clinkers are obtained; and the vanadium-contained raw material clinkers are leached in an ammonium phosphate solution to extract vanadium, and vanadium extracting tailings and a vanadium-contained leaching agent are obtained after solid-liquid separation is carried out. According to the method, the vanadium selective leaching efficiency is high and can reach more than 90%; meanwhile, leaching of impurity element is less, preparation of products with the high-purity vanadium is facilitated, and brine waste is avoided; the leaching agent-ammonium phosphate solution used in the method does not volatilize, and the problem of ammonia gas volatilization is avoided; and in addition, the leaching technological process of the method is simple, the operation environment is friendly, and the production cost is low.

technical field

[0001] The invention belongs to the technical field of vanadium chemical industry and metallurgy, and relates to a method for extracting vanadium from clinker after roasting vanadium-containing raw materials, in particular to a method for extracting vanadium from roasted clinker by leaching vanadium-containing raw materials and additives with ammonium phosphate. Background technique

[0002] The method for extracting vanadium from vanadium slag is roasting-water leaching method, among which sodium roasting-water leaching of vanadium-containing raw materials is the mainstream method for vanadium extraction. Examples

Embodiment 1

[0036] will V 2 o 5 11% vanadium slag mixed with calcium source, CaO / V 2 o 5 The molar ratio is 2.5, and the clinker obtained after calcification and roasting at 700°C for 4 hours is leached to extract vanadium in a solution containing 200g / L ammonium phosphate. The leaching temperature is 30°C, the leaching liquid-solid ratio is 20mL / g, and the leaching time is 5h. Vanadium tailings and vanadium-containing leachate.

[0037] The leached slag was washed, dried, weighed and analyzed for the vanadium content of the residue. It was tested that the vanadium transfer leaching rate was 92%.

Embodiment 2

[0039] will V 2 o 5 15% mixed with calcium source, CaO / V 2 o 5 The molar ratio is 3, and the clinker obtained after calcification and roasting at 600°C for 5 hours is leached to extract vanadium in a solution containing 700g / L ammonium phosphate, the leaching temperature is 90°C, the leaching liquid-solid ratio is 5mL / g, and the leaching time is 0.5h. Vanadium tailings and vanadium-containing leachate.

[0040] The leached slag was washed, dried, weighed and analyzed for the vanadium content of the residue. It was tested that the vanadium transfer leaching rate was 92%.

Embodiment 3

[0042] will V 2 o 5 20% vanadium slag mixed with calcium source, CaO / V 2 o 5 The molar ratio is 2, and the clinker obtained after calcification and roasting at 800°C for 3 hours is leached to extract vanadium in a solution containing 600g / L ammonium phosphate. The leaching temperature is 70°C, the leaching liquid-solid ratio is 10mL / g, and the leaching time is 1h. Tailings and vanadium-containing leachate.

[0043] The leached slag was washed, dried, weighed and analyzed for the vanadium content of the residue. It was tested that the vanadium transfer leaching rate was 95%.
